Healthcare Social Workers salary by percentile in Louisiana
BLS-reported salary distribution — from entry-level (10th percentile) to top earners (90th percentile).
Healthcare Social Workers in Louisiana earn a median salary of $61,080 per year ($5,090/month).
This is 11.0% below the national average of $68,608.
Louisiana ranks #43 out of 51 states for Healthcare Social Workers pay.
Approximately 1,970 people work in this occupation across Louisiana.
Salaries decreased by 5.1% compared to 2024.
About This Job: Healthcare Social Workers
Provide individuals, families, and groups with the psychosocial support needed to cope with chronic, acute, or terminal illnesses. Services include advising family caregivers. Provide patients with information and counseling, and make referrals for other services. May also provide case and care management or interventions designed to promote health, prevent disease, and address barriers to access to healthcare.

Salary Range: Healthcare Social Workers in Louisiana
Salaries for Healthcare Social Workers in Louisiana range from $43,830 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$79,170 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$57,450 and $73,340.

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2025 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.
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
